For those channels, you might want to go in and make sure that both your HD channels in the Comcast box is set to a widescreen format. Then, check to make sure your television is in the 16x9 format. Often times, the symptoms you describe are merely picture settings on the wrong setting from either the source or the television.
Since it's just happening on HD channels, there may be a special function in the box that controls widescreen HD content, and your best bet to resolve that might be as simple as phoning in the cable company and having one of the techs walk you through the settings.

I looked through the first ten pages of threads and couldn't find this one. I have my LN46A550 connected to my Comcast DVR box using component cables. Have no complaints except for a few channels where the picture is wider than the screen. I watch CNBC a lot to monitor my investments and love the extra info on the HD version except the top/bottom info bars extend beyond the edge. Had the same problem watching TNT HD programming. No problem with the usual broadcast channels (ABC/CBS/NBC). Anybody know how to adjust this?
